Mahama mocks Nana Addo's ‘1 district, 1 factory’
President John Mahama has described the pledge by the New Patriotic Party’s (NPP) flagbearer, Nana Akufo-Addo to build one factory in every district as an election wining promise.
According to him, political considerations will not force the National Democratic Congress (NDC) into promising to build a factory in each of the 216 districts in the country.
He said “I know somebody is talking of one factory, one district,” he said.
John Mahama made this known during his presentation of to a cross-section of Ghanaians, the highlights of the National Democratic Congress (NDC) manifesto for 2016.
Mahama said, “Location of industries means taking cognition of the whole value chain: the source of raw material, availability of utility services – water, electricity; closeness to markets and a whole raft of issues that we learnt in sixth form economics.”
Nana Akufo-Addo started this trend when he promised to build a factory each in all 216 districts in Ghana if he emerges winner of the upcoming elections.
